What Drives Kitchen Renovation Costs in Whitby
Understanding your investment across Durham Region’s hub town:
| Factor | Cost Impact |
|---|---|
| Kitchen Size | Larger Whitby detached homes mean more materials and labour |
| Layout Changes | Wall removal or island addition: $3,000–$8,000 |
| Cabinet Quality | Builder-grade vs. custom: 2-3x price difference |
| Countertop Material | Laminate ($25/sq ft) to quartzite ($145/sq ft) |
| Appliance Upgrades | Standard vs. premium: $4,000–$18,000 range |
| Structural Work | Load-bearing wall removal with engineered beam: $3,500–$7,000 |
Whitby’s Housing Eras and Kitchen Challenges
Whitby has expanded in distinct waves, and each era presents unique kitchen renovation opportunities:
Downtown & Port Whitby (Pre-1980): Character homes and bungalows with smaller, closed-off kitchens. Often feature solid construction but cramped layouts, limited counter space, and outdated wiring. These benefit most from strategic wall removal and complete modernization.
Pringle Creek & Established Areas (1980s–1990s): Mature subdivisions with oak cabinets, laminate counters, linoleum floors, and separated dining rooms. Solid bones with dated everything. Open-concept conversions and full material upgrades transform these homes.
Williamsburg & Blue Grass Meadows (2000s–2010s): Family-focused homes with larger footprints but builder-grade finishes — maple or thermofoil cabinets, basic granite, peninsula layouts blocking family room views. Ready for quality upgrades.
Whitby Shores, Taunton & North Whitby (2015+): Newer construction with adequate layouts but generic builder finishes. Early customization opportunities before builder materials start showing wear.
Open-Concept Conversions: Whitby’s Most Transformative Upgrade
The majority of Whitby homes built before 2010 have partially or fully closed kitchens. Opening them up is our most-requested service:
Why closed kitchens don’t work for modern families:
- Parents can’t supervise kids while cooking
- Entertaining means the cook is isolated
- Limited natural light reaches interior spaces
- Homes feel smaller and more compartmentalized
- Resale value suffers against open-concept competition
What proper open-concept delivers:
- Sightlines from kitchen to family and dining areas
- Natural light flowing through connected spaces
- Better traffic flow for daily routines and entertaining
- Significantly increased perceived home size
- Modern layout expected by today’s buyers
Engineering matters: Load-bearing wall removal requires structural engineering, proper steel or LVL beams, building permits, and inspection. We handle every step — never guess on structural work.
Typical open-concept conversion cost: $3,500–$8,000 for structural work, plus finishing costs for the expanded kitchen.

Builder-Grade vs. Quality Renovation: What Actually Changes
What Whitby homeowners gain when upgrading from typical builder standard:
| Builder-Grade | Quality Renovation |
|---|---|
| Thermofoil or basic maple fronts | Painted MDF or solid wood shaker |
| Particleboard cabinet boxes | Furniture-grade plywood boxes |
| Basic friction hinges | Blum soft-close (200,000-cycle rated) |
| Builder granite or laminate | Premium quartz or natural stone |
| Peninsula blocking sightlines | Functional island with seating |
| Four recessed pot lights | Three-layer lighting (ambient, task, accent) |
| Minimal storage solutions | Pull-outs, organizers, pantry system |
| Basic contractor tile | Designer backsplash with sealed grout |

Whitby Townhouse Kitchen Renovations
Whitby’s growing townhome inventory along Taunton Road and in newer communities presents unique opportunities:
Townhouse kitchen challenges:
- Compact footprints (often 8 ft × 10 ft or smaller)
- Limited wall space for upper cabinets
- No room for traditional islands
- Shared walls affecting plumbing and electrical routing
- Condo corporation or freehold rules to navigate
Smart solutions for small Whitby kitchens:
- Cabinets extended to ceiling — maximum storage in minimal footprint
- Mobile island or peninsula with storage underneath
- Light-coloured finishes that visually expand space
- Integrated appliances that maintain clean sightlines
- Reflective backsplash materials that bounce light
- Pull-out and pull-down organizers that use every inch
Typical Whitby townhouse kitchen renovation: $15,000–$35,000 depending on scope and material selections.

Questions Every Whitby Homeowner Should Ask Kitchen Contractors
Before signing with any contractor:
- ✅ Licensed, WSIB-covered, and $5M+ liability insured?
- ✅ Portfolio of completed Whitby and Durham Region projects?
- ✅ Experience with your home’s specific era of construction?
- ✅ References from families in your neighbourhood?
- ✅ Structural engineering capability for open-concept conversions?
- ✅ Detailed written contract with itemized line-by-line costs?
- ✅ Dedicated project manager assigned to your project?
Red flags: No local references, unfamiliar with Town of Whitby permits, large upfront deposits (never pay more than 10-15% to start), vague “allowance” pricing, unwilling to provide written timeline.
Whitby Kitchen Renovation by Neighbourhood: What to Expect
| Neighbourhood | Typical Home Era | Common Scope | Estimated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Downtown Whitby | Pre-1980 | Full gut + structural | $35K–$75K |
| Pringle Creek | 1980s–1990s | Complete modernization | $25K–$55K |
| Williamsburg | 2000s–2010s | Cabinet + counter + island | $22K–$50K |
| Blue Grass Meadows | 2000s | Builder upgrade + open concept | $25K–$55K |
| Whitby Shores | 2010s+ | Customization + premium finishes | $25K–$60K |
| Taunton Corridor | 2015+ | Builder-grade elevation | $18K–$40K |
| Brooklin | 2010s+ | Builder upgrade + island | $20K–$50K |
Ranges based on average kitchen sizes in each area. Actual costs depend on specific scope, materials, and structural requirements.
